Phone number listed for Leonard is (603) 487-3361. Leonard’s residency is at 837 Mountain Rd, Lyndeborough, Nh 03082. Other cities that he has stayed in are Brockton, Middleboro and Lakeville. This year Leonard celebrated his 64 birthday. Leonard was born in 1960.